My Grandpa, O'Neill Edward Clark served in WWII, he was with the 5th Engineers Special 336th Combat Battalions. I recently read a short letter he wrote years ago describing some of his time spent in the war and he now has Alzheimer's and I would like to know more but he isn't able to tell me... I am hoping to find out as much as I can. My great Aunt, his sister Jane Paige also served in WWII, she was a nurse.

Well... Sadly, my precious Grandpa left this earthly world late Wednesday night, the 9th of December. He just turned 91 last month. My sweet Great Aunt Jane, that served with him, cried beside his casket saying, "Now I can't protect you. I can't keep you safe anymore." She turned 94 in June and joined the army as a nurse to 'take care of' her baby brother. The service was beautiful. We had family from New York, California, New Mexico, Texas, and all over Oklahoma. Friends and family told stories about him and I got to learn a lot about him in his younger years. He left a positive impression on everyone he came in contact with.
